Simple Harmonic Motion (least time taken)

Level 1

A particule P is moving along the x-axis. At time t seconds the displacement, x meters,of P from the origin O is given by x=4sin2t ... Now, Calculate the least value of t (t>0) for which P's speed is 4 ms^-1.
